St. Paul, MN – One political analyst in Minnesota is reporting Governor Tim Walz could end his bid for a third term.
WCCO Radio’s Blois Olson says he learned Walz will likely drop out of the governor’s race today. His office says Governor Walz is holding a media availability at 11 a.m. to take questions and discuss news of the day. Olson says Walz met with U.S. Senator Amy Klobuchar about his political future.
Republicans and the White House have been blaming Walz for the Feeding Our Future fraud scheme and other fraud in Medicaid and Department of Human services programs.
